How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 60625?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 60625 Studio Apartments | $1,514 | $900 | $1,825 |
| 60625 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,894 | $1,000 | $4,400 |
| 60625 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,530 | $1,200 | $4,100 |
| 60625 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,315 | $1,995 | $6,495 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 60625 ZIP Code Apartments with Parking
What is the Cheapest Parking apartment in 60625?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in 60625 with Parking is at The Vista listed at $570.
How much is the average rent for 60625 Apartments with Parking?
The average rent for a Apartment in 60625 with Parking is $1,983.
What is the largest 60625 Apartment for rent with Parking?
Today's Apartment with Parking and the most square footage in 60625 is a 1,510 square feet unit starting from $570 at The Vista.
What is the average size for 60625 Apartments for rent with Parking?
The average size for a rental with Parking in 60625 is currently at 700 sq ft.
